This is an fine program cast sheet from a performance of Donizetti's L’elisir d’amore at the Metropolitan Opera House, New York City on October 13, 1973. It was signed after the show by soprano Roberta Peters, who sang the role of Adina in the performance. It is in great condition, with slight yellowing. It measures approximately 8 x 11 in.

Here is a very nice First Day Cover (FDC) signed by soprano Roberta Peters. The FDC celebrates the centennial of the Metropolitan Opera in New York City and is postmarked Sept. 14, 1983. It contains drawings of the new and old Met on the envelope. The cover is in great condition. Some shadows appear on the scanned photo that are not on the actual envelope (it is not dirty or stained). Peters added “Best wishes” along with her autograph.
